Balancing Entertainment and Responsible Play

While innovation drives engagement, the industry has also committed to prioritising responsible gambling. Features such as deposit limits, self-exclusion options, and reality checks are now standard. Industry regulators and operators collaborate to develop comprehensive frameworks ensuring player safety.1
